A heap, or playing with fire. 3rd edition, supplemented. Vodolagin A.V.
“A heap, or playing with fire” is a novel-investigation that reveals the driving forces of the “secret history” of Russia, the confrontation of supporters of the total westernization of the country and its best people, opposing the transformation of Russia into a colonial appendage of Western civilization. Using the archival materials classified until recently, the author recreates the spirit and psychological atmosphere of the past century, withdrawing real faces without masks - L. I.? Brezhnev, M.A. Suslova, Yu. V.? Andropova, B. N.? Yeltsin , V.V. Putin and others. The main event unfolds in 1997-2001 around the largest gas concern, promoting his person to the Kremlin in accordance with the scenario in Washington. The competing group-the Association of former employees of the KGB liquidated by Yeltsin-neutralizes the actions of the Gas Mafia, holds its protege as president of Russia, planning to restore the imperial statehood-the Russian-Eurasian Continental Union. In 2011, the author of the book was awarded the Literary Prize named after N.V. Gogol.
